The Benefits Of Studying Electrical Engineering With Foundation Year

For aspiring engineers looking to pursue a career in electrical engineering, a foundation year can be a valuable stepping stone towards success A foundation year is a program designed to provide students with the necessary knowledge and skills to transition into a degree in electrical engineering This article will explore the benefits of studying electrical engineering with a foundation year and how it can set students up for success in this challenging and rewarding field.

One of the main advantages of studying electrical engineering with a foundation year is that it provides students with a solid grounding in the fundamental principles of engineering The foundation year covers topics such as mathematics, physics, and computer programming, which are essential for understanding the principles of electrical engineering By building a strong foundation in these subjects, students can develop the analytical and problem-solving skills that are crucial for success in the field.

Another benefit of a foundation year is that it allows students to explore their interests and strengths before committing to a specific area of study Electrical engineering is a broad field that encompasses a wide range of specialties, such as power systems, telecommunications, and electronics By taking a foundation year, students can gain exposure to different areas of electrical engineering and determine which ones align with their interests and career goals This can help students make more informed decisions about their academic and professional paths.

Furthermore, a foundation year can help students bridge the gap between high school and university-level education For students who may not have studied certain subjects in depth during high school, a foundation year can provide the additional support and instruction needed to succeed in a degree program in electrical engineering This can be particularly beneficial for students who come from non-traditional backgrounds or who may need extra time to adjust to the rigor of university-level coursework.

In addition to academic benefits, studying electrical engineering with a foundation year can also open up new opportunities for students Many universities offer bridge programs that allow students to progress directly from a foundation year into an undergraduate degree program in electrical engineering This seamless transition can save students time and money, as they can complete their studies in a shorter period of time and avoid duplicating coursework Additionally, some universities offer scholarships and other financial incentives for students who successfully complete a foundation year, making it a cost-effective option for those seeking a degree in electrical engineering.
